Dunkin Donuts Iced Cake Batter Latte Recipe Ingredients and Kitchen Utensils

For the Cake Batter Syrup:

  • 1 cup of water
  • 2 cups of granulated sugar
  • 2 teaspoons of cake batter extract

For the Iced Latte:

  • 2 tablespoons of cake batter syrup (homemade)
  • 2 cups of ice cubes
  • 3 ounces of brewed espresso (cold) or cold brew coffee
  • 2 cups of milk (whole, 2%, or your preferred variety)
  • Whipped cream (optional, for topping)

Kitchen Utensils Needed:

  • Small saucepan
  • Measuring cups and spoons
  • Two tall glasses (16 oz capacity)
  • Long spoons for stirring
  • Espresso machine or coffee maker
  • Airtight container for syrup storage

Preparation and Cooking Time

Prep Time: 5 minutes
Cook Time: 10 minutes (for syrup)
Total Time: 15 minutes
Servings: 2 iced lattes

Dunkin Donuts Iced Cake Batter Latte Recipe Instructions

Making the Cake Batter Syrup:

Step 1: Combine 1 cup of water and 2 cups of granulated sugar in a small saucepan over medium heat.

Step 2: Stir the mixture continuously until the sugar completely dissolves, about 5-7 minutes. The liquid should become clear and slightly thickened.

Step 3: Remove the saucepan from heat and allow the syrup to cool for 2-3 minutes.

Step 4: Stir in 2 teaspoons of cake batter extract until fully incorporated. Your homemade cake batter syrup is now ready!

Step 5: Transfer the syrup to an airtight container and let it cool completely before using (or refrigerate for faster cooling).

Assembling the Iced Cake Batter Latte:

Step 6: Fill two tall glasses generously with ice cubes, filling them about three-quarters full.

Step 7: Pour 1 tablespoon of your homemade cake batter syrup into each glass, letting it settle at the bottom.

Step 8: Divide the 3 ounces of cold brewed espresso (or cold brew coffee) evenly between the two glasses, pouring it over the syrup and ice.

Step 9: Pour 1 cup of milk into each glass, watching as the layers begin to swirl together.

Step 10: Use a long spoon to stir each latte thoroughly, ensuring the syrup is evenly distributed throughout the drink.

Step 11: Top with a generous dollop of whipped cream if desired, and serve immediately with a straw.

Expert Tips for the Perfect Cake Batter Latte

1. Brew Your Espresso in Advance: For the best iced cake batter latte, always prepare your espresso ahead of time and let it cool completely in the refrigerator. Hot espresso will melt your ice immediately, diluting the drink and ruining the texture. Brew your shots 30 minutes before assembling, or keep cold brew concentrate on hand for instant iced coffee drinks anytime.

2. Syrup Consistency Matters: When making your cake batter syrup, achieving the right consistency is crucial for proper flavor distribution. The syrup should be slightly thicker than water but still pourable. If it’s too thin, it won’t provide enough sweetness; too thick, and it won’t mix well. Simmer the sugar-water mixture until it coats the back of a spoon lightly-this indicates perfect consistency.

3. Quality Extract is Key: The cake batter extract is the star ingredient that makes this copycat Dunkin Donuts iced cake batter latte recipe authentic. Don’t substitute with just vanilla extract, as you’ll miss the distinctive buttery, batter-like flavor. LorAnn or Watkins brand cake batter extracts work exceptionally well. If you can’t find cake batter extract, combine equal parts vanilla extract, butter extract, and almond extract as a substitute.

4. Ice Matters More Than You Think: Use large, solid ice cubes rather than crushed ice for slower melting and less dilution. Consider making coffee ice cubes by freezing leftover coffee in ice cube trays-this way, as they melt, they enhance rather than water down your latte. This trick keeps your drink perfectly flavored from first sip to last.

5. Milk Temperature and Fat Content: Cold milk straight from the refrigerator works best for maintaining the iced nature of this beverage. Whole milk or 2% provides the creamiest texture that’s closest to what Dunkin’ uses, but if you’re watching calories, even skim milk works well. For an extra indulgent version, substitute half of the milk with half-and-half or heavy cream.

6. Layer for Visual Appeal: While stirring is necessary for flavor distribution, you can create a beautiful layered effect by pouring slowly and carefully. Pour the milk over the back of a spoon held just above the coffee layer-this creates that gorgeous gradient effect perfect for photos before stirring. The visual presentation makes your homemade cake batter latte feel even more special.

7. Adjust Sweetness to Taste: The recipe provides a balanced sweetness, but everyone’s preferences differ. Start with 1 tablespoon of syrup per glass and taste before adding more. Remember, whipped cream adds additional sweetness, so if you’re topping your latte, you might want slightly less syrup. Keep your homemade syrup in a squeeze bottle for easy portioning and adjustments with each drink you make.

Storage and Reheating Guidance

Store your homemade cake batter syrup in an airtight container or glass jar in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 weeks. The high sugar content acts as a natural preservative. Always use a clean spoon when dispensing to prevent contamination. The prepared iced latte should be consumed immediately for best taste and texture.

Common Queries and FAQs

Can I make this without an espresso machine?

Absolutely! Use strong brewed coffee, cold brew concentrate, or even instant espresso powder dissolved in a small amount of cold water. The key is using concentrated coffee for that robust flavor that stands up to the milk and syrup.

Where can I buy cake batter extract?

Cake batter extract is available at most craft stores like Michael’s or Hobby Lobby in the baking section, on Amazon, or at specialty baking supply stores. LorAnn Oils and Watkins are reliable brands that deliver authentic cake batter flavor.

How can I make this recipe healthier?

Reduce the sugar in the syrup by half (using 1 cup instead of 2), use unsweetened almond milk, skip the whipped cream, and consider using monk fruit sweetener or stevia as a sugar substitute in the syrup.

Can I use vanilla extract instead of cake batter extract?

While vanilla extract provides sweetness, it won’t replicate the distinctive buttery, batter-like flavor that makes this a true cake batter latte dunkin copycat. For the most authentic taste, cake batter extract is essential.

Is cold brew or espresso better for this recipe?

Both work wonderfully! Cold brew provides a smoother, less acidic taste with subtle sweetness, while espresso delivers a bolder, more intense coffee flavor. Choose based on your preference-cold brew for mellow mornings, espresso for a stronger caffeine kick.

Can I make a hot version of this latte?

Yes! Simply use hot espresso and steamed milk instead of cold versions, and omit the ice. The cake batter syrup works perfectly in hot beverages too, creating a cozy alternative for cooler weather.
